Is a sewage leak dangerous?

Another potential danger of a sewer gas leak is hydrogen sulfide poisoning. This is a highly toxic gas that can be fatal at high concentrations. Exposure to low concentrations irritates the eyes and causes dizziness, nausea, and headache, but high concentrations can lead to unconsciousness and death.

Classification 1 is the Have a peek at this website least serious on the IICRC scale, and also includes water damage such as busted pipelines and also supply of water lines, sinks and bath tubs which have actually overruned, and different home appliance concerns. The major factor this type of damages is thought about less serious is that it includes "clean water," i.e. water that is sewage as well as toxin-free. Typically, most things damaged in category 1 cases can be dried conveniently without and possible adverse effects for the property owner later. This can be from incorporated pipelines, implying that your stormwater and also raw sewer are streaming into the exact same pipeline. This kind of system places your residence at risk for overloaded pipes, causing a sewer backup. A sewer spill or sewer back-up happens when there's a clog from your home's wastewater to the city's sewage system, causing the sewage to back up right into your residence.
